Chiefs cut MVS save $12-million on cap

The Kansas City Chiefs have cut wide receiver Marquez Valdes-Scantling saving $12-million against they salary cap.

MVS caught eight passes for 116 yards in the AFC Championship game in 2022 as the Chiefs beat the Cincinnati Bengals but has found impressive performances harder and harder to come by.

Chiefs receiver rumour ripe for another makeover

It seems every season now the Chiefs head coach Andy Reid is happy to revolve around different wide receivers as their key weapon is still QB Patrick Mahomes. Despite having a league high 34 drops Mahomes produced his third Super Bowl win.

MVS never really became a consistent threat in Kansas and saw his targets drop from 87 in 2022 to just 52 in 2023. His 443 receiving yards were the second lowest in his six years in the league, while his 2 touchdowns were the joint lowest.

His case for remaining on the roster was severely weakened by the arrival and impressive rookie season of Rashee Rice. Rice finished with 1,200 yards, 8 touchdowns, and 105 catches to lead all the Kansas City Receivers not name Travis Kelce.
